YSL Y Le Parfum (often referred to as simply Y): The Crisp, Modern Classic
Launched as the original Y scent, Y Le Parfum establishes a foundation of freshness and sophistication. It's a fragrance designed for the modern man—ambitious, confident, and stylish. The scent opens with a burst of vibrant notes, typically featuring a prominent bergamot, a citrusy top note that provides an immediate invigorating feeling. This freshness is quickly softened by a heart of geranium and apple, adding a subtle sweetness and a touch of unexpected complexity. The base notes, often including cedarwood and amberwood, provide a warm, woody grounding that prevents the fragrance from being overly sharp or fleeting.
The overall impression of Y Le Parfum is one of clean masculinity. It's versatile enough for both daytime and evening wear, suitable for professional settings and social gatherings alike. It's a fragrance that's generally well-received and inoffensive, making it a safe bet for those who prefer a more understated yet refined scent. Its relatively lighter projection makes it a suitable choice for office environments or situations where a more subtle fragrance is preferred. Longevity is generally moderate, lasting around 6-8 hours on average, depending on skin type and application.
YSL Y Eau de Parfum Intense: A Deeper, More Sensual Experience
YSL Y Eau de Parfum Intense takes the core elements of the original Y and amplifies them, creating a richer, more intense, and undeniably captivating fragrance. This is not simply a stronger version of the original; it's a distinct evolution, offering a more sensual and luxurious experience. While still maintaining a fresh opening, the citrus notes are less dominant, allowing the heart and base notes to take center stage. The heart often features more pronounced spicy notes, adding a layer of warmth and intrigue. The base notes are significantly enriched, with a more prominent presence of woody and ambery accords, resulting in a deeper, more sensual and longer-lasting scent.
The overall impression of Y Intense is one of confident sophistication with a touch of mystery. It's a more assertive fragrance, commanding attention without being overpowering. The increased projection makes its presence known, creating a noticeable but not overwhelming sillage. Longevity is significantly improved compared to the original Y, often lasting 8-12 hours or even longer on certain skin types. This makes it ideal for evening events, romantic dates, or any occasion where you want to make a lasting impression. The increased intensity makes it a more powerful statement, suitable for those who appreciate a bolder, more assertive fragrance.
